Carpentry Level 1 (also Piledriver & Bridgeworker Level 1)
This six-week technical training will be of interest for any first year Carpentry or Piledriver and Bridgeworker Apprentices. The program follows the Year One curriculum as set out by the Industry Training Authority (ITA) for both the four-year Carpentry Apprenticeship Program, and the three-year Piledriver and Bridgeworker Apprenticeship Program.
Program Topics
- A description of the carpentry trade
- Safe work practices
- Interpreting drawings and specifications
- Hand tools
- Portable power tools
- Shop equipment
- Survey instruments
- Site layouts
- Building concrete formwork
- Framing residential housing
